Continental to charge $65 to check in two luggage items
FRIDAY, JULY 15: Continental Airlines are to slap a $65 charge on passengers checking in two bags on trips from Bermuda, the company announced yesterday.
The airline will impose a $25 charge for one bag and $40 for a second on some economy class tickets bought from today for travel on or after August 15.
Previously, the first bag was free, with a $30 charge for a second.
Rebecca Cunha of Global Travel, Hamilton, said the increases were most likely driven by the cost of fuel surcharges.
She said: “People will get upset and make a fuss about it, but I see all the airlines doing something similar in the future.”
Continental passengers travelling in first and business classes, and Elite customers, will be exempt.
US Airways charges $25 for a first checked bag and $35 for a second. Delta and American Airlines allow one checked bag free with a $30 charge for a second.
